School Exclusion Zones
School Exclusions Zones (SEZ) are in place at a number of schools within North Perthshire. These have been introduced to improve safety for vulnerable pedestrians by reducing vehicular traffic during school start and finish times.
SEZ are defined areas of restricted access around schools which are clearly identified by signage and flashing lights when the scheme is in operation. These are access restrictions, not parking restrictions and apply only during school term times.
Community Police Officers will be carrying out focused patrols and enforcement at SEZ in North Perthshire in the coming weeks.
Should Police find anyone driving within these zones during periods of restriction and without a valid permit, the driver of the vehicle will be issued with a fine.
